Adrienne Willis must rethink her entire life when her husband abandons her for a younger woman, leaving her to raise their teenage children and care for her sick father alone. Reeling with heartache and in search of a respite, she flees to the small coastal village of Rodanthe, North Carolina, to tend to a friend's inn for the weekend. But as a major storm starts brewing, it appears that Adrienne's perfect getaway will be ruined - until an unexpected guest named Paul Flanner arrives. Paul has also come to Rodanthe to escape his own shattered past. Now, with a fierce nor'easter closing in, two wounded people will turn to each other for comfort - and in one weekend set in motion feelings that will resonate throughout the rest of their lives.
